For 1–7 Grades on IB Courses: 7 = 99–100 6 = 92–98 5 = 84–91 4 = 77–83 3 = 70–76 2 = 50–69 1 = Failing Grade. Results from the IB Diploma are reported on a numerical scale between 24 and 45 and are mapped to an IB Admissions Score (IBAS, which as noted above is used to obtain an ATAR-like rank) to allow IB Diploma students to be considered for tertiary places alongside their counterparts who have completed state curricula.
